MediusEcho / ParticleHatsWiki

1 stars 0 forks source link

Could not pass EntityDamageByEntityEvent on v4.0.0-RC1 #7

Closed HyperKids closed 5 years ago

HyperKids commented 5 years ago

Occurs when punching a Citizen NPC. Completely destroys KitPvP plugins that I am using as well...

[22:36:02 ERROR]: Could not pass event EntityDamageByEntityEvent to ParticleHats v4.0.0-RC1 java.lang.NullPointerException: null at com.mediusecho.particlehats.player.PlayerState.(PlayerState.java:60) ~[?:?] at com.mediusecho.particlehats.ParticleHats.getPlayerState(ParticleHats.java:308) ~[?:?] at com.mediusecho.particlehats.listeners.EntityListener.handleCombat(EntityListener.java:124) ~[?:?] at com.mediusecho.particlehats.listeners.EntityListener.onEntityDamage(EntityListener.java:69) ~[?:?] at com.destroystokyo.paper.event.executor.asm.generated.GeneratedEventExecutor1431.execute(Unknown Source) ~[?:?] at org.bukkit.plugin.EventExecutor.lambda$create$1(EventExecutor.java:69) ~[patched_1.14.2.jar:git-Paper-86] at co.aikar.timings.TimedEventExecutor.execute(TimedEventExecutor.java:80) ~[patched_1.14.2.jar:git-Paper-86] at org.bukkit.plugin.RegisteredListener.callEvent(RegisteredListener.java:70) ~[patched_1.14.2.jar:git-Paper-86] at org.bukkit.plugin.SimplePluginManager.callEvent(SimplePluginManager.java:536) ~[patched_1.14.2.jar:git-Paper-86] at org.bukkit.craftbukkit.v1_14_R1.event.CraftEventFactory.callEvent(CraftEventFactory.java:223) ~[patched_1.14.2.jar:git-Paper-86] at org.bukkit.craftbukkit.v1_14_R1.event.CraftEventFactory.callEntityDamageEvent(CraftEventFactory.java:968) ~[patched_1.14.2.jar:git-Paper-86] at org.bukkit.craftbukkit.v1_14_R1.event.CraftEventFactory.handleEntityDamageEvent(CraftEventFactory.java:867) ~[patched_1.14.2.jar:git-Paper-86] at org.bukkit.craftbukkit.v1_14_R1.event.CraftEventFactory.handleLivingEntityDamageEvent(CraftEventFactory.java:1000)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.EntityLiving.damageEntity0(EntityLiving.java:1680)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.EntityHuman.damageEntity0(EntityHuman.java:847)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.EntityLiving.damageEntity(EntityLiving.java:1095)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.EntityHuman.damageEntity(EntityHuman.java:770)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.EntityPlayer.damageEntity(EntityPlayer.java:743) ~[patched_1.14.2.jar:git-Paper-86] at net.citizensnpcs.nms.v1_14_R1.entity.EntityHumanNPC.damageEntity(EntityHumanNPC.java:142) ~[?:?] at net.minecraft.server.v1_14_R1.EntityHuman.attack(EntityHuman.java:1031)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.EntityPlayer.attack(EntityPlayer.java:1668)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.PlayerConnection.a(PlayerConnection.java:2063)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.PacketPlayInUseEntity.a(PacketPlayInUseEntity.java:51)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.PacketPlayInUseEntity.a(PacketPlayInUseEntity.java:6)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.PlayerConnectionUtils.lambda$ensureMainThread$0(PlayerConnectionUtils.java:18)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.TickTask.run(SourceFile:18)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.IAsyncTaskHandler.executeTask(IAsyncTaskHandler.java:127)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.IAsyncTaskHandlerReentrant.executeTask(SourceFile:23)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.IAsyncTaskHandler.executeNext(IAsyncTaskHandler.java:105)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.MinecraftServer.aW(MinecraftServer.java:999)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.MinecraftServer.executeNext(MinecraftServer.java:992)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.IAsyncTaskHandler.executeAll(IAsyncTaskHandler.java:91)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.MinecraftServer.sleepForTick(MinecraftServer.java:975) ~[patched_1.14.2.jar:git-Paper-86] at net.minecraft.server.v1_14_R1.MinecraftServer.run(MinecraftServer.java:909) ~[patched_1.14.2.jar:git-Paper-86] at java.lang.Thread.run(Unknown Source) [?:1.8.0_191]

momoservertw commented 5 years ago

I have this error too. Please~~

MediusEcho commented 5 years ago

Uploaded a new version with a fix. https://github.com/MediusEcho/ParticleHatsWiki/releases/tag/4.0.0-RC2